It's that time again, folks: Black Friday sales are live. Lots of Apple gadgets are on sale for record-low prices this week, including all current- and recent-gen iPads. But to be honest, the iPad deals are kind of lame. Sure, most models are down to their lowest prices, but we were hoping for even bigger discounts.
Shoppers can save anywhere from $50 to $200 on Apple tablets across major retailers like Amazon, Best Buy, Walmart, and Target. (The Apple Store itself is just giving away free gift cards with eligible Black Friday purchases, so it's pretty skippable.)
Below, we've rounded up the absolute best Black Friday iPad deals available right now. Deals are maxing out at 25% off and the basic iPad is the best deal at the moment, going for $274. Why we like it
This Black Friday, we would have loved to see a sub $250 iPad, but alas, we'll take a $274 iPad instead.
Our favorite budget iPad is now more affordable than ever: Amazon and Walmart have the 128GB base model on sale for just $274, or $75 off. (It's 99 cents pricier at Target but Best Buy finally matched its price.) The 11-inch tablet comes with a peppy A16 chip, Touch ID, and 12MP front and rear cameras. "[It's] great for someone who wants a portable screen for streaming, playing games, and reading," according to our reviewer. If you bundle it with an also-on-sale USB-C Apple Pencil or first-gen Apple Pencil, it's still cheaper than any iPad Air or Pro.

Why we like it
Now that the M5 chip has arrived, the 13-inch M4 iPad Pro is no longer the shiniest new model on the market — but that doesn't mean much in the era of iterative upgrades. When our reviewer tested it last year, she said it "blew us away with its power efficiency, striking display, and breakneck performance." It's overkill for most people, but great for professional artists and creatives. While most of this week's Black Friday iPad discounts top off around $50 to $100, this M4 iPad Pro's 256GB base model is chilling at $200 off. It's $100 cheaper than its M5 equivalent.
